De-oiled Lecithin Market Overview

De-oiled Lecithin Market (USD Million)

De-oiled Lecithin Market was valued at USD 249.97 million in the year 2024.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 453.44 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 8.9%.

The De-oiled Lecithin Market is undergoing significant expansion, driven by increasing demand for natural emulsifiers. Adoption has surged by approximately 5%, fueled by consumer inclination towards low-fat, clean-label options. This momentum positions de-oiled lecithin as a crucial component across a variety of industries.

Product Attributes
De-oiled lecithin’s unique profile, with over 95% phospholipid concentration, ensures enhanced stability and solubility. A reduction of approximately 8% in oil content makes it an ideal choice for delivering consistent functionality in product formulations. Its versatility has amplified interest across multiple sectors.

Technological Innovations
Innovative processing methods have increased production efficiency by approximately 6%, resulting in higher-purity de-oiled lecithin. These advancements improve residual oil control and maximize phospholipid yield, aligning with industry demands for superior quality ingredients. Enhanced production processes ensure reliable product performance.
